Both roles involve data entry tasks in a remote setting, requiring similar skills and certifications. The main difference is the work schedule, with the Full Time Remote Data Entry Operator working full-time hours, while the Part Time Remote Data Entry Clerk works fewer hours. Employers often seek candidates with basic data entry skills for both positions, making them comparable in credentials and work environment.
